The Indian Health Service announced a hotline to accept reports of suspected child or sexual abuse following controversy involving a pediatrician who was convicted of crimes against young patients.
Anyone with information about abuse within the IHS system can call 1-855-SAFE-IHS (855 723-3447), where they will be directed to trained personnel, 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. Written complaints can also be submitted on ihs.gov.
"Protecting our patients and our employees from sexual abuse in a supportive environment is a priority at the Indian Health Service," IHS Acting Director Elizabeth Fowler, a citizen of the Comanche Nation, said in a news release on Tuesday.
